About this book

This volume details protocols for computer-assisted design and experimental characterization of RNA nanostructures. Chapters guide readers through RNA nanotechnology, design and characterization of RNA nanostructures, assessment of immunology of nanomaterials, biosensing and drug delivery, various biomedical applications, and delivery approaches for therapeutic RNA nanoparticles. Written in the format of the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ology series, each chapter includes an introduction to the topic, lists necessary materials and reagents, includes tips on troubleshooting and known pitfalls, and step-by-step, readily reproducible protocols. 

  Authoritative and cutting-edge, RNA Nanostructures: Design, Characterization, and Applications aims to address essential topics and concerns in the growing field of RNA nanotechnology.
